The patient receiving an albuterol treatment by nebulizer in the clinic complains of tremors, nausea, blurred vision, and headache. Which of the following actions should the medical assistant take? 1. Decrease the oxygen flow meter to three liters per minute. 2. Report these symptoms to the physician. 3. Place the patient on NPO status. 4. Tell the patient these are common side effects. answer: Report these symptoms to the physician. Which of the following is likely considered outside the scope of practice for a medical assistant? 1. verify equipment functionality using a control material 2. perform additional tests on different instruments for validation 3. record quality control results on a log sheet 4. perform CLIA high complexity tests answer: perform CLIA high complexity tests A CMP is ordered for an older adult patient whose veins continue to collapse despite drinking water. Which of the following is the best collection method for this patient? 1. evacuated tube system 2. needle and syringe 3. capillary puncture 4. butterfly needle Answer: butterfly needle When preparing to assist the physician with collection of a deep wound culture, the medical assistant should have which of the following available? 1. blood culture media 2. viral transport media 3. bacterial culture swabs 4. cotton tipped swabs Answer: bacterial culture swabs Forced Vital Capacity is measured by instructing the patient to 1. forcefully breath air out and continue to exhale for at least 6 seconds. 2. complete a minimum of eight acceptable efforts to validate the test. 3. move the one way valve to a minimum of 4000 ml capacity. 4. gently exhale for less than 6 seconds and document the reading. answer: forcefully breath air out and continue to exhale for at least 6 seconds.
